New York, NY and Santa Barbara, CA The American Federation for Aging Research (AFAR) and the Glenn Foundation for Medical Research announce the 2021 recipients of three grant programs:the Glenn Foundation for Medical Research and AFARGrants for Junior Faculty, the Glenn Foundation for Medical ResearchPostdoctoral Fellowships in Aging Research,andthe Glenn Foundation for Medical Research Breakthroughs in Gerontology (BIG) Awards.Collectively, these three grant programs will provide close to $2,260,000 in support of biomedical research on aging.
TheBreakthroughs in Gerontology (BIG) Awardsprovide $300,000 for research projects that offer significant promise of yielding transforming discoveries in the fundamental biology of aging or that build on early discoveries with the potential for translation to clinically relevant strategies, treatments, and therapeutics to benefit human aging and healthspan.
TheGrants for Junior Facultyprovide early career investigators with up to $100,000 to support research focused on biological aging processes. Ten grants are awarded in 2021.
ThePostdoctoral Fellowships in Aging Researchsupport postdoctoral fellows who research basic mechanisms of aging and/or translational findings that have potential to directly benefit human health. This year, eleven $60,000 Fellowships are awarded.

The Glenn Foundation for Medical Research and AFAR have collaborated for four decades. In addition to establishing the Glenn Foundation for Medical Research, the late Paul F. Glenn was a founding member of the AFAR Board of Directors. In addition to their grant programs, AFAR and the Glenn Foundation also co-host annual scientific meetings to foster the exchange of ideas and to promote new scientific collaborations in biology of aging research. The Glenn Foundation for Medical Research has invested close to $30 million and supported 559 investigators through its programs and other initiatives with AFAR.

About the Glenn Foundation for Medical ResearchFounded in 1965 through the philanthropy ofPaul F. Glenn, the Glenn Foundation for Medical Research, Inc., (GFMR) is a 501(c)(3) non-profit private foundation. The mission of the GFMR is to extend the healthy years of life through research on mechanisms of biology that govern normal human aging and its related physiological decline, with the objective of translating research into interventions that will extend healthspan with lifespan. Over the past two decades the GFMR has funded over $110 Million in research in support of its mission, including the establishment of Paul F. Glenn Centers for Biology of Aging Research at Harvard Medical School, Massachusetts Institute of Technology, Princeton University, Stanford University, Salk Institute, University of Michigan, Mayo Clinic, Albert Einstein College of Medicine and the Buck Institute for Research on Aging.
